Output 84dfc36134aa66dd173bbe3f9fbe9b01dbc741dc5cf19c886ef048e8f6094e01:1

value
198690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34ff0d3403c32036784f602b50c6d4531a28b8e6 OP_EQUAL
address
36XEbp7JwAo3pQT68CzhSy6MqyopXU3n2p
transaction
84dfc36134aa66dd173bbe3f9fbe9b01dbc741dc5cf19c886ef048e8f6094e01
spent
true